National Mall, Washington, DC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in National Mall?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| National Mall Studio Apartments | $2,182 | $1,150 | $7,759 |
| National Mall 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,014 | $1,250 | $10,000+ |
| National Mall 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,252 | $1,579 | $10,000+ |
| National Mall 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,627 | $1,682 | $10,000+ |
| National Mall 4 Bedroom Apartments | $9,922 | $6,875 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about National Mall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in National Mall?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in National Mall with Washer/Dryer is at 555 listed at $1,246.
How much is the average rent for National Mall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in National Mall with Washer/Dryer is $4,329.
What is the largest National Mall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in National Mall is a 4,843 square feet unit starting from $3,716 at 2800 Olive St NW.
What is the average size for National Mall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in National Mall is currently at 656 sq ft.
